As Markham spoke, he glanced up in the direction of the pathetic figure groping there amongst the ruin, and as he did so he saw Dorn standing there before him. The latter must have heard what Markham was saying; indeed, he was standing so close by that it was impossible for him not to have done so. And besides, his face was dark and angry, and there was an ugly expression in his eyes.
"What are you doing here?" he demanded. "What right have you got in my grounds? So this is what is going on right under my very nose, is it? You sneak over here in my absence and make love to my daughter without asking my permission. A pretty dishonourable thing to do."
